If the output doesn't align with your prompt, first review your description for clarity—vague or conflicting instructions can confuse the model. Be specific about subject, action, camera movement, and style. If you uploaded a starting image, ensure it's high-quality and well-composed; blurry or low-resolution inputs lead to degraded animation. Visual artifacts like flickering or unnatural motion often result from overly complex prompts or abstract concepts. Simplify the scene, reduce the number of simultaneous actions, or break the concept into multiple shorter clips. Regenerating with a different seed can also resolve one-off glitches.
